Overall Meaning

The song "Joy to the World" by Ron Brown is a Christian hymn that celebrates the birth of Jesus Christ. The first stanza begins with a proclamation that the Lord has come, and urges the earth to receive Him as its King. The stanza then calls on every person to prepare their hearts to make a room for Him. The chorus reiterates the message that heaven and nature are singing in unison about the arrival of the Lord. The second stanza shifts the focus to the reign of the Savior, and calls on men to employ their voices in joyful songs. The fields, floods, rocks, hills, and plains are called upon to repeat the sounding of joy that is ringing out.


The third stanza speaks to the hope that the Lord's coming brings to the world. It declares that the reign of sin and sorrow is over, and that the ground is free from thorns. The Lord has come to make His blessings flow, as far as the curse is found. The final stanza celebrates the Lord's rule over the world with truth and grace, and the wonders of His love that He has shown to humanity. Overall, the song is a declaration of joy and hope that comes with the birth of Jesus Christ, and an urging to celebrate Him through praise and song.
